Accommodation
Black Beach Suites consists of a total of 20 stylish and standalone studios, each with a breathtaking view of the black sand beaches, the ocean, or the impressive Icelandic landscape. You can choose from three different room types: the Standard Studio, the Superior Studio King, and the Deluxe Studio King.
- The Standard Studio is compact but comfortably furnished, with a cozy seating area, kitchenette, bathroom with shower, and a private terrace.
- The Superior Studio King offers more space and a larger seating area, ideal for longer stays or if you desire a bit more comfort.
- The Deluxe Studio King is the most luxurious, with the best location and the most panoramic views, stylish decor, and extra amenities for an even more comfortable stay.
All studios feature a king-size bed, a private modern bathroom with a shower, a fully equipped kitchenette, and a terrace with a view. The large windows provide plenty of daylight and bring nature inside, as it were. The interior is minimalist and modern, with warm Scandinavian accents in wood and natural colors. The atmosphere is one of tranquility, comfort, and complete connection with the surroundings.

Activities
The area around Vík is one of the most beautiful and diverse regions of Iceland, and Black Beach Suites is the perfect base to explore it. Some highlights:
- Visit the famous Reynisfjara beach with its black sand and basalt columns
- Walk to the Dyrhólaey viewpoint for spectacular views
- Glacier hikes or ice cave excursions at Sólheimajökull
- Photograph the iconic Vík church with the mountains and sea in the background
- Day trips to the waterfalls Skógafoss and Seljalandsfoss
- Horse riding, quad tours, or snowmobile tours in the region
- In winter: spot the northern lights directly from your terrace
This region offers a wide range of activities all year round – from relaxing to adventurous.
